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,323,889,943
Lastest Block:
1,960,449
Utxos:
1,983,754
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
16/07/2025 15:46:56 UTC
Txid
1d7db29f4088c5809454fb99b3f48fcfea9a011098a73ca80e35ad20967dea42
Block
1,795,869
Block hash
2164075a40706e7ef8d3445fc331291db166fd757eacf8245568fb50dc16bfa0
Stake amount
55.38628225 XEP
Sender
ep1qqp58sqwj83r4sejaukq02k50a05cat34s5vnyw
Recipient
ep1qqp58sqwj83r4sejaukq02k50a05cat34s5vnyw
(677,632.24967753 XEP)